A track rod end is the joint at the end of the tie rod through which force from the rack reaches the hub carrier. It wears predictably: the ball pin beats out its seat, play appears, and with it come knocking over bumps, imprecise steering and uneven tyre wear. Checking it yourself is not hard, provided you know what to hold and where to put your hand — that is what separates a useful check from a pointless one.
What you are looking for
Inside the joint there is a ball pin in a polymer or metal seat, sealed by a rubber boot. While the boot is intact the joint lasts a long time: grease inside, dirt outside. As soon as the boot tears, sand and water get in, the seat wears and the pin starts moving in its housing. So the first thing to do is simply to inspect the boots: cracks and squeezed-out grease often make the diagnosis before any test.
The second sign, available without tools, is how the steering behaves. Growing free play, a vague feel around the straight-ahead, knocks felt through the wheel over small bumps and the car wandering after braking add up to the typical picture of a worn steering linkage.
Checking with the wheel raised
Follow the safe raising procedure in full — chocks, a support under the sill, handbrake applied. Then the technique is this:
- Take the wheel at 3 and 9 o’clock (the sides) and rock it in the horizontal plane with short, sharp movements.
- Play and knocking in this grip point at the steering linkage: the track rod end, the tie rod or the rack itself.
- Without changing the movement, place a palm on the track rod end joint. A knock felt through your fingers condemns it.
- Move your hand to the inner joint of the tie rod and repeat. That separates the outer element from the inner one.
- As a control, rock the wheel at 12 and 6 o’clock: play in that grip belongs to the wheel bearing or the ball joint instead.
A helper speeds things up noticeably: while they rock the steering wheel through a small angle, you hold your hand on each joint in turn.
Separating the sources
| Where the knock is felt | Part | What next |
|---|---|---|
| In the track rod end joint | Track rod end | Replace, then align |
| In the joint by the rack | Inner tie rod | Replace the rod |
| In the rack housing, by the boot | Steering rack | Adjustment or repair |
| In the ball joint below | Ball joint | Replace |
| In the anti-roll bar link | Anti-roll bar link | Replace, a small job |
The anti-roll bar link is worth checking first: it produces a similar sharp knock over small bumps and costs a fraction of any steering component. The general picture of knocks at the front is on the symptom page knocking in the suspension.
How the repair is decided
Two practical points shape the job. A seized track rod end sometimes cannot be removed without damaging the tie rod, and a workshop should warn you about that possibility in advance rather than after the fact. And replacing track rod ends in pairs usually makes sense: they wear at the same rate, and doing one means a second visit and a second alignment a month later.
Wheel alignment afterwards is part of the job, not an extra — and it is worth asking for the printout, because that is what shows the toe was actually set rather than eyeballed.
